🦅talon (タロン)

noun
/ˈtælən/
(tsume)

意味

A claw, especially one belonging to a bird of prey.
意味の翻訳
特に肉食鳥の爪。
Toku ni nikushoku chou no tsume.

例文

The eagle gripped the fish with its sharp talons.

ワシはその魚を鋭い爪で捕まえた。
Washi wa sono sakana o surudoi tsume de tsukamaeta.

同義語

claw, hook, fang, pincer

対義語

hoof, paw

コロケーション

sharp talons, eagle's talon, grip with talons, powerful talon
